WebFeb 6, 2024 · High blood sugar levels when you wake up. If your fasting glucose before breakfast is 100–125 mg/dL (5.6–6.9 mmol/L), it’s higher than doctors would expect to see in a person with healthy blood sugar control.. Fasting blood glucose in this range means you could have prediabetes — a health condition that significantly increases your risk of … WebNov 7, 2024 · Fruit can be a helpful part of your meal when you're trying to watch your blood sugar. WebAug 4, 2006 · So even though after-meal high blood glucose levels are temporary (often resembling a spike when plotted on a graph), frequent between-meal rises can cause your HbA1c to go up. Research on the effects of postprandial hyperglycemia has shown an increase in the risk of death from heart disease in those with Type 2 diabetes and earlier … WebNov 6, 2024 · Whole-grain crackers with tuna fish and a bit of olive oil. A normal blood glucose reading after fasting overnight is between 70 and 100 milligrams per deciliter. … dwight fitness orbWebChoose healthier flours. Another way to make desserts healthier is to use whole-grain or real food flours instead of refined flour. These flours are higher in fiber and nutrients than their refined counterparts, and they can help you feel fuller for longer. Some great options include whole wheat flour, oat flour, coconut flour and almond flour. dwight fitzsimons charlottesville
